Michael Liarakos and Katie Williams Win Undergraduate Park Award
Michael
Liarakos and Katie Williams were awarded the Park Undergraduate
Scholarship Award. This award, given annually by the Computer Science
faculty was established in 2001 as a gift from the estate of Steve
Park, former chair of the department. In the wording of his bequest:
At
least one award, of at least $1000, presented annually at the end of
the spring semester to a graduating Computer Science undergraduate
student who during his or her undergraduate career "established a
record of academic excellence and, equally important, demonstrated a
continuing interest in computer science research and development, as
judged by the joint faculty of the Computer Science department, or a
subcommittee thereof.
